Output e96e436139dd5c51adcdb0771ffa5c29490a152cdaa8274e52d4e5c368b2ff74:18
- value
- 629204
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f013e80443847b5cc0072e5a7a1172d71a580a6f OP_EQUAL
- address
- 3PaRwhSZyf69uCoJJpCjEUppmbvDKwZbWe
- transaction
- e96e436139dd5c51adcdb0771ffa5c29490a152cdaa8274e52d4e5c368b2ff74
- confirmations
- 248407
- spent
- true